The Very Venerable Khenchen Thrangu Rinpoché founded Shree Mangal Dvip Boarding School in Kathmandu, Nepal in 1987 to serve the needs of impoverished children from the high Himalayas, including Tibetan refugees. The Kathmandu Valley lies in a high-risk seismic zone where a massive earthquake is expected any time now. Most vulnerable is the school's oldest building, a four-storey dormitory block. It houses over two hundred children. In 2003, a similar school dormitory in Bingol, Turkey, collapsed in a heap of rubble killing many children. The same could happen in Kathmandu.

Thrangu Rinpoché has asked Karma Tashi Ling, his centre in Edmonton, Canada to focus on helping the school. We have responded to this in part by initiating a ‘seismic retrofit’ for the dorm block by strengthening with structural steel cross-bracing and reinforced concrete walls. Working with a team of volunteer engineers and students, a preliminary design is underway. Ideally some of the work would be carried out in monsoon (summer 2004), when half of the students have returned to their families in the mountains, many days trek away.
